mourning cloak

Nymphalis antiopa

Habitat:

Douglas-fir-western redcedar forest, within a patch of alder near a snowmelt stream.

Notes:

Although patches of snow were present, and the day was overcast, this individual was observed flying and basking. The first butterfly of the season for me.
